Output 18345a7912c92c4b3f8b298b0c62b80dd9efb01e1aa123b9406aa852122b4f6f:4

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6021e3c94e63ab4d05fbc503dfffa087dcfb1f9 OP_EQUAL
address
3MCb4mHtiDc3WjfJhvVSyWiFsyNkTx7Xoj
transaction
18345a7912c92c4b3f8b298b0c62b80dd9efb01e1aa123b9406aa852122b4f6f
spent
true